Transaction 5916e9320aac7b6f7740317f36404e45f93bfcd31c819c8fa80b067ca7eb8071

3 Input
2 Outputs
  • 5916e9320aac7b6f7740317f36404e45f93bfcd31c819c8fa80b067ca7eb8071:0
  • value  66836857
    address  12LxfrLSauiFYcVBNTTMUKx88439TEBJFT
  • 5916e9320aac7b6f7740317f36404e45f93bfcd31c819c8fa80b067ca7eb8071:1
  • value  7466
    address  1DjCUgorMVZgwa66AgU6LTy5yDZyLCmQMf